An Interpretable Local Editing Model for Counterfactual Medical Image Generation

arXiv – CS AI|Hyungi Min, Taeseung You, Hangyeul Lee, Yeongjae Cho, Sungzoon Cho||1 views
🤖AI Summary

Researchers developed InstructX2X, a new AI model for generating counterfactual medical images that provides interpretable explanations and prevents unintended modifications. The model achieves state-of-the-art performance in creating high-quality chest X-ray images with visual guidance maps for medical applications.

Key Takeaways
  • InstructX2X introduces region-specific editing to prevent unintended changes in demographic attributes while modifying disease features.
  • The model provides interpretable visual explanations through guidance maps, addressing a key limitation in existing approaches.
  • Researchers created MIMIC-EDIT-INSTRUCTION dataset from expert-verified medical VQA pairs for counterfactual image generation.
  • The approach achieves state-of-the-art performance across all major evaluation metrics for medical image generation.
  • The technology enables AI systems to answer 'what-if' questions in medical imaging with enhanced transparency.
